Rectangular Non-Metallic Expansion Joint Definition and Components
A Rectangular Non-Metallic Expansion Joint is a flexible connector designed for rectangular ductwork in piping systems. It compensates for thermal expansion, vibration, and misalignment while containing pressure. Unlike metallic joints, it is constructed from composite fabrics and elastomers, offering greater flexibility, lower spring rates, and superior corrosion resistance in many applications.
- Main Parts: Flexible Bellows (The Core): Multi-layered fabric construction.
- Common layers include:Inner Liner: Fluid-contacting layer (e.g., PTFE, EPDM, Silicone-coated fabric) for chemical/temperature resistance.
- Architecture Fabric: Primary strength layer (e.g., Aramid fiber, Fiberglass, Polyester) providing mechanical strength.
- Insulation Layer (Optional): Thermal or acoustic insulation material.
- External Cover: Protective layer (e.g., neoprene-coated fabric, Hypalon) against weather, UV, and abrasion.
- Frame (Reinforcement): Rectangular structural frame, typically steel (often galvanized or stainless), to which the bellows are attached. It provides mounting flanges and maintains shape under vacuum.
- Flanges / Connection Legs: Integrated with the frame for bolting to the adjacent ductwork. Can be drilled to match specified bolt patterns.
- Control Rods / Tie Rods (Optional but common): External hardware that limits axial compression/extension, absorbs pressure thrust, and prevents over-extension. They do NOT restrain lateral movement unless designed as a "tied" universal joint.
- Internal Liner / Flow Media (Optional): A removable PTFE or metallic liner to protect the bellows from abrasive or high-temperature direct flow.
- External Covers / Shields (Optional): Metal or composite guards to protect the bellows from mechanical damage.
Role, Characteristics, and Application Scenarios of Rectangular Non-Metallic Expansion Joint in Pipelines

- Movement Absorption: Compensates for thermal expansion/contraction, vibration, and equipment settlement/sag in rectangular duct systems.
- Misalignment Correction: Accommodates initial axial, lateral, and angular installation offsets between duct sections.
- Noise & Vibration Dampening: The flexible fabric significantly reduces structure-borne noise and vibration transmission.
- Pressure Containment: Designed to contain system pressure (positive or negative/vacuum) within its rating.
Características operativas:
- Low Spring Rate: Requires less force to compress/extend than metallic joints, reducing stress on anchors.
- Multi-Directional Movement: Can simultaneously absorb movements in multiple planes.
- Temperature Range: Typically -40°F to +450°F (-40°C to +232°C), extendable with special materials.
- Chemical & Corrosion Resistance: Inherently resistant to many corrosive atmospheres where metals would fail.
- Lightweight: Easier to install than heavy metallic counterparts.
Primary Application Scenarios:
- Power Plant Flue Gas Ductwork (SCR, FGD Systems): The most critical and common application. Handles large thermal movements and corrosive gases.
- Industrial Process Gas Ducts: In cement, steel, chemical, and pulp/paper plants.
- HVAC Systems for Large Buildings/Airports: Connects fans, chillers, and ducts, isolating vibration.
- Marine Exhaust Systems: Compensates for engine movement and thermal growth.
- Turbine Inlet/Exhaust Connections: Gas and steam turbine installations
Rectangular Non-Metallic Expansion Joint Standards: Materials, Design, and Connections

Fabric Materials:
- Fibers: Aramid (e.g., Nomex®, Kevlar® per DuPont specs), Fiberglass (ASTM D578), Polyester (ASTM D885).
- Coatings: Silicone Rubber (ASTM D771), PTFE (Film or Impregnated, per ASTM D5748), EPDM, Chloroprene (Neoprene, per ASTM D2000).
- Frame & Hardware: Steel (ASTM A36), Galvanized per ASTM A123, Stainless Steel (ASTM A240, Grade 304/316).
- Bolts/Nuts: ASTM A193/A194 or stainless equivalent.

Primary Standard: EJMA (Expansion Joint Manufacturers Association) Standards - The global authority for design, manufacture, and testing of expansion joints, covering both metallic and non-metallic.
Application-Specific:
- Power/Flue Gas: Often designed to client/engineering specifications (e.g., from Bechtel, Fluor, etc.) referencing EJMA.
- HVAC: SMACNA (Sheet Metal and Air Conditioning Contractors' National Association) guidelines for ductwork.
- Pressure & Vacuum Rating: Designed per EJMA calculations. Must be clearly stamped/marked.
- Movement Capacity: Rated for axial, lateral, and angular movements per EJMA.
Normas de conexión:
- Flange Drilling: Typically follows ANSI/ASME B16.1 (Cast Iron) or B16.5 drill patterns for the given rectangular dimensions, or as per detailed customer drawings.
- Face-to-Face Dimensions: Custom per order, but constrained by minimum installable length for required movement.
- Gasketing: Supplier usually provides a recommended gasket type (e.g., ceramic fiber, graphite) based on service.
How to Select Rectangular Non-Metallic Expansion Joint
Define Comprehensive Specifications:
- Duct Dimensions (ID): Clear Inside Width & Height.
- Design Conditions: Operating & Maximum Temperature, Design Pressure (Positive & Vacuum).
- Required Movements: Quantify all movements (Axial Compression/Extension, Lateral, Angular) from thermal and mechanical analysis.
- Media & Environment: Exact gas composition, presence of abrasives/catalysts, and external environment.
- Connection Details: Flange thickness, bolt size/quantity/hole pattern, face-to-face length.
- Special Features: Need for internal liner, external covers, purge connections, control rods, etc.

- Request project references and case studies.
- Review their engineering and quality manuals.

- Require detailed General Arrangement (GA) drawings and material breakdown list for approval before manufacture.
- Obtain design calculations (based on EJMA) for review, especially for critical applications
- Compare warranties, lead times, and scope of supply (e.g., are gaskets and bolts included?).

Pre-Shipment Inspection for Export Rectangular Non-Metallic Expansion Joint and Key Considerations

- Approved GA drawings vs. as-built.
- Material Certificates (MTCs) for fabrics, coatings, frame steel, bolts.
- Weld Procedures & Welder Qualifications (for frame).
- Certified Design Calculations (a critical deliverable).
Inspección visual y dimensional:
- Verify overall dimensions, flange flatness, and bolt hole alignment.
- Inspect fabric bellows for uniformity, contamination, or surface defects.
- Check quality of seams and bonds in the fabric.
- Verify all welds on the frame are clean and continuous.
- Ensure proper installation and function of any control rods/latches.
- Confirm nameplate data (Size, Pressure, Temp, Movements) matches PO.
Functional & Pressure Testing:
- Leak Test (Most Common): A pressure hold test (air or water) at 1.5x design pressure per EJMA. Soap solution applied to all seams and connections.
- Vacuum Test: For joints designed for vacuum service, tested to the specified vacuum level.
- Movement Setup Verification (Critical): Inspectors must verify the joint is preset correctly (if required by design) for installation at ambient temperature. This is often marked clearly on the frame. Incorrect preset is a common cause of field failure.
- Proof of Movement Test (Optional/Rare): Full-scale movement testing is seldom done on large rectangular joints due to facility constraints but may be simulated or verified by inspection of the restraint system setup.
Envasado y conservación:
- Fabric bellows must be protected from moisture, UV, and physical damage. Shipped with protective plastic/vinyl covers.
- Flange faces painted with protectant and covered with plywood/plastic.
- Internal cavity should be blocked or braced to prevent collapse during shipping.
- Securely mounted in a rigid, weather-protected crate. Large joints may require custom crating.

- Preservation is Paramount: Non-metallic fabrics are sensitive to moisture, oil, and sunlight. Packaging must ensure they arrive on site in factory-fresh condition.
- Preset Verification: The single most important check for the end-user. Confirm the marked installation length/cold setting matches your project's installation temperature requirements from the piping stress analysis.
- Third-Party Inspection (TPI): Highly recommended for large, critical joints. The TPI inspector should witness the final pressure test and preset verification.
- Spare Materials: Purchase a kit of the exact bellows fabric material for field repairs.
